patsy's yellow rice

We love yellow rice. I buy a spice in the Hispanic section of the store called Bijol,it says it's a coloring and seasoning.It says it's all natural and no preservatives. It really has no flavor it just makes the rice yellow. I don't measure when I cook,but I just made this rice so these measurements are approximate. Use more Bijol if you want a darker colored yellow rice.If your broth is salty,do not add additional salt. If I use a bouillon cube,no salt is needed. Taste the broth before you cook the rice. The pimiento is optional.I sometimes add green bell pepper for color as well.

Ingredients For patsy's yellow rice
-
1/4 c oil
-
2 cloves garlic,minced
-
1/2 medium onion
-
1 c rice
-
1/4 c chopped pimientos,drained
-
2 c chicken broth
-
1 t. salt
-
1/2 t. black pepper
-
1/4 t bijol
How To Make patsy's yellow rice
-
1Heat oil in a saucepan. Add garlic and onion unit onion is tender. Add rice and toast just a bit. Add pimiento,broth,salt,pepper and bijou.Bring to a boil. Turn the heat as low as possible and cook rice 20 minutes. Turn off heat and let the rice sit covered a few minutes.
